I think this extraordinary concert ought to be dedicated to Sonia Slany, violinist, who passed away in 2021. She was so talanted and perhaps not everyone watching knows that she wrote the amazing and beautiful string arrangements for this concert. For me the string quartet transform Mark's masterpiece “Brothers In Arms” into a place the song hasn't been before. It's so beautiful and emotionaly strong, making the song touch my heart in a way no other version ever has. This truly is a unique concert with masterful performances by Mark and all the musicians, simply remarkable!! ❤️ and🙏🎶 Always, Carin in Sweden

@ThomasWilliamsMusik9 ай бұрын
Would be nice, but if the original was shot on tape there's not much advantage to the Blu Ray format in terms of quality because the source quality is already relatively poor - compare the recent remasters of Pink Floyd's Delicate Sound Of Thunder (film) vs Pulse (tape), or even the difference between location (film) and studio (tape) footage on the classic Doctor Who Blu Rays.
